Introduction to Phemex

Phemex is a global cryptocurrency exchange platform that provides both individual and institutional traders with the tools to buy, sell, and trade a wide range of cryptocurrencies. The exchange offers a comprehensive set of features, including spot trading, derivatives, and staking. What sets Phemex apart from other exchanges is its zero-fee spot trading, user-friendly interface, and advanced trading options such as futures contracts with high leverage. Despite being a relatively new player in the cryptocurrency space, phemex trading platform has quickly garnered attention for its innovative approach to digital asset trading.

The platform provides access to a wide variety of cryptocurrencies, ranging from the top-tier assets like Bitcoin and Ethereum to smaller, emerging altcoins. Phemex is designed to cater to traders of all experience levels, offering tools and features that suit both beginners and more advanced market participants. Additionally, the exchange has prioritized security by incorporating strong protective measures such as cold storage for funds and two-factor authentication (2FA).

Key Features of Phemex

1. Zero-Fee Spot Trading

One of the most attractive features of Phemex is its zero-fee spot trading model. Most cryptocurrency exchanges charge a small fee for each trade executed, typically between 0.1% and 0.5% of the total transaction amount. These fees can quickly add up, particularly for active traders. Phemex distinguishes itself by offering zero-fee spot trading for most pairs, enabling users to buy and sell cryptocurrencies without incurring transaction costs.

This feature is highly beneficial for traders who execute multiple trades throughout the day. By removing the burden of trading fees, Phemex provides a cost-effective platform for both beginners and experienced traders. However, it’s important to note that futures trading and certain other services may still incur fees, so users should review the platform’s fee schedule for more detailed information.

3. Futures and Derivatives Trading

For more experienced traders, Phemex offers access to derivatives trading, including futures contracts. Futures contracts allow users to speculate on the future price of cryptocurrencies and can be used to hedge positions or amplify potential returns using leverage.

The platform supports perpetual contracts, which are a type of futures contract that does not have an expiration date. This gives traders the flexibility to hold positions for as long as they want without worrying about the contract’s expiry. Furthermore, Phemex provides users with leverage of up to 100x on futures trades, which is one of the highest leverage ratios in the industry.

However, it’s essential to note that leverage trading increases both the potential for profits and the risk of significant losses. Therefore, leverage should be used cautiously, especially by beginners.

6. High Security Standards

Security is a primary concern for any cryptocurrency exchange, and Phemex takes this issue seriously. The platform uses a combination of cold storage and hot storage to ensure that user funds are kept safe. Cold storage means that the majority of user funds are stored offline, which significantly reduces the risk of hacking attempts.

In addition to cold storage, Phemex employs two-factor authentication (2FA) to protect user accounts from unauthorized access. The platform also offers an Anti-Phishing Code, which helps prevent users from falling victim to phishing scams.

Phemex is committed to adhering to international security standards and follows strict regulatory compliance measures to protect both user data and funds. These security features provide peace of mind to traders who may be concerned about the safety of their assets on the platform.

Phemex vs. Other Trading Platforms

When comparing Phemex to other popular cryptocurrency exchanges, it stands out for its zero-fee spot trading, its focus on security, and its high leverage options for derivatives trading. Here’s how Phemex stacks up against some other leading platforms:

Binance:

  • Binance is one of the largest and most well-known exchanges globally. While it offers a wide range of cryptocurrencies, Phemex has the advantage of zero-fee spot trading. Binance charges spot trading fees, though users can reduce them by using the BNB token.
  • Binance also provides a more complex interface, which might be intimidating for beginners, whereas Phemex offers a simpler and more intuitive experience.

Coinbase:

  • Coinbase is widely regarded as one of the most user-friendly exchanges, but it charges relatively high fees on its trades, especially for smaller transactions. Phemex, in contrast, offers zero-fee spot trading, making it a more cost-effective option.
  • Coinbase also has fewer options for advanced traders, particularly when it comes to derivatives and leverage, whereas Phemex caters to professional traders with its futures contracts and leverage options.

Kraken:

  • Kraken offers a range of cryptocurrencies and advanced trading features but charges trading fees for spot trading. Kraken’s platform can also be more complex, whereas Phemex provides a more streamlined user interface.
